Seven more IT companies are set to start operations from Medha Towers, the IT park in Gannavaram near here from Wednesday, according to Ravi Vemuru, the CEO of the AP Non-resident Telugu Society.

He said the state IT Minister and the Chief Minister's son, N. Lokesh, would inaugurate the seven companies in Medha Towers on Wednesday.

The seven companies are Groupto Antolin, IES, Rotomaker, Chandu Soft, Melsova, EP Soft, and Yamyah IT Solutions. These companies offer solutions in high-end automotive interior designing, IT consultancy, digital educational services, ITES services, projects and products.

It is estimated that together the seven companies may generate 1,500 jobs.
